Creative Ideas for the Perfect Christmas Dinner

Christmas is a time for sharing, and nothing brings people together like a well-prepared and meaningful dinner. Finding the perfect inspiration for your menu can feel overwhelming with so many options available, but with a bit of creativity and a personal touch, you can transform your Christmas dinner into an unforgettable experience.

1. The Internet: Your Best Ally for Innovative Ideas

  • YouTube: A quick search for “creative Christmas dinner recipes” will yield countless step-by-step videos. From traditional dishes to vegan or gluten-free options, the possibilities are endless.
  • Pinterest: Create themed boards to organize your ideas. For example, explore complete menus or search by categories like appetizers, main courses, and desserts.
  • Social Media: Platforms like Facebook or Instagram are full of groups and hashtags related to Christmas. Tip: Ask questions in cooking groups or check trending “Reels” for quick inspiration.

2. Traditional Sources with a Personal Twist

While the internet offers endless options, family traditions and classic resources shouldn’t be overlooked:

  • Grandmas and Moms: My personal experience taught me the value of seeking ingredients with a story. One Christmas, I bought organic honey from a local farm and used it to glaze a ham that became the centerpiece of our dinner. This small gesture not only added a unique flavor but also created a special connection with the food I served.
  • Friends: Sharing recipes with friends can open doors to new ideas, especially if they come from different cultural backgrounds. Imagine enriching your menu with a traditional dish from another region or country.

3. The Charm of Cookbooks and Magazines

In a digital world, cookbooks and magazines still hold their charm:

  • Cookbooks: Visit your local bookstore or library and look for Christmas-specific publications. This approach allows you to explore dishes that may not be trending online.
  • Magazines: Many magazines release holiday specials with pre-planned menus, making your planning process easier.

4. Ingredients with a Story

Incorporating ingredients with special meaning can elevate your Christmas dinner to a whole new level. For me, that organic honey didn’t just make my glazed ham delicious; it also reminded me of the connection I had with the vendor who sold it. Adding emotional value to your menu ensures your guests will remember it forever.

5. Avoid Overwhelm: Less is More

A common mistake is trying to do too much. Decide on a theme or focus:

  • Traditional dinner: Inspired by classic family recipes.
  • Modern menu: Incorporating new culinary trends.
  • Minimalist dishes: Fewer, high-quality courses with a lasting impact.

6. Plan Ahead for Success

Select your recipes at least two weeks in advance and create a detailed shopping list. If an ingredient has special significance or is hard to find, like that artisan honey, make sure to secure it early.
